Headline: Untethered Power: Why V2L is the EV Feature You Didn't Know You Needed 🚗⚡
Electric vehicles are no longer just about transportation; they are becoming mobile power plants. The latest buzz surrounding the V2L (Vehicle-to-Load) integration in the new [Insert Car Model/39link] is a perfect example of this shift.
For those asking, "What exactly is V2L?"—it stands for Vehicle-to-Load. Essentially, it turns your EV into a giant portable battery pack on wheels.
Why the new V2L implementation on the [Model Name] is a game-changer:
🔌 Campers' Dream: No need to lug around heavy portable power stations. You can run an electric grill, coffee maker, and string lights directly from your car battery.
🛠️ Job Site Ready: Power your drills, saws, and laptops remotely without needing a grid connection or a noisy gas generator.
🆘 Emergency Backup: During power outages, V2L allows you to run essential appliances (like a fridge or medical devices) by plugging them directly into the car’s charging port.
